NEW: Munetsi on target as Reims gets off the mark 

Online Reporter 

VERSATILE Zimbabwean footballer, Marshall Munetsi, opened the scores for Reims who registered their first win of the 2022/2023 French Ligue 1 campaign, after thumping Angers 4-2 at Stade Raymond Kopa on Wednesday night.

The 26-year-old midfielder was set up by Arbër Avni Zeneli of Kosovo to score Reims’ first goal after 23 minutes.

Japanese Juaja Ito, Folarin Balogun and Alexis Patrice scored the other goals for Reims who now have five points from five games.

Adrien Hunou and Sofiane Boufal were on target for hosts Angers.

Munetsi took to social media soon after, to celebrate the crucial victory.

“Amazing team spirit today to get our first victory of the season, first goal of the season. We keep going,” wrote Munetsi on his Facebook page.

Next up for Reims is a home fixture against Lens on Sunday.
